Here Are The Essential Skills For A Chief AI Officer

15 August 2023

In today’s data-driven and AI-centric corporate environment, the role of the Chief AI Officer (CAIO) has evolved from a niche position to a strategic imperative for many organizations. The rise of this position signifies the growing importance of artificial intelligence in reshaping business models, optimizing operations, and forging new frontiers. However, the critical question arises: What skills should this pivotal figure possess?

The responsibilities of a CAIO extend beyond merely understanding AI as a tool. They are the lighthouse guiding an organization's AI journey, ensuring it sails smoothly while avoiding the perilous pitfalls. In this light, let's explore the essential skills a CAIO needs to be successful.

  1. Technical Proficiency in AI and Data Analytics While a CAIO doesn't need to be the most adept programmer or data scientist in the room, a solid understanding of the technical nuances of AI is indispensable. This includes comprehension of machine learning algorithms, neural networks, and other advanced AI techniques. Such proficiency allows the CAIO to engage in meaningful dialogues with technical teams, understand challenges, and make informed decisions.
  2. Strategic Vision A CAIO's primary role isn't just to implement AI but to align it with the organization's larger objectives. This requires a vision that can integrate AI strategies seamlessly with business goals. Whether it's enhancing customer experiences, streamlining operational processes, or creating new revenue streams, the CAIO needs to pinpoint where AI can be leveraged for maximum impact.
  1. Ethical and Regulatory Insight In an era where concerns about data privacy, algorithmic biases, and ethical implications of AI are rising, a CAIO must possess a keen understanding of these domains. They must be equipped to create frameworks that not only adhere to regulations but also align with ethical standards, ensuring AI's responsible and transparent usage.
  1. Change Management and Leadership Introducing AI often means heralding organizational change. The CAIO should be adept at change management, ready to tackle resistance, dispel myths, and foster a culture that embraces AI. Leadership skills are paramount. The CAIO should inspire teams, cultivate trust, and ensure that all stakeholders, from top-level executives to frontline employees, are aligned in the AI journey.
  1. Effective Communication The realm of AI is replete with jargon, from "deep learning" to "neural architectures." However, for AI to be embraced organization-wide, its concepts need to be communicated in a way that's accessible to all. The CAIO must be an effective communicator, translating complex AI notions into digestible insights for various stakeholders.
  1. Continuous Learning Mindset AI is a dynamic field. What's revolutionary today may be outdated tomorrow. A CAIO must be inherently curious, always on the lookout for the latest developments, ready to adapt, and eager to innovate. This drive ensures the organization remains at the forefront of AI advancements.
  1. Collaboration and Cross-functional Interaction AI's impact isn't confined to a single department. Its ripples are felt across functions, from marketing to HR. Thus, a CAIO should be a collaborator par excellence, capable of interacting with diverse teams, understanding their unique challenges, and integrating AI solutions that cater to their specific needs.
  1. Business Acumen While the CAIO role is deeply intertwined with technology, at its heart, it's a business role. A deep understanding of the business landscape, market dynamics, and organizational challenges ensures that AI initiatives are not just technically sound but also strategically viable.

The role of a Chief AI Officer, while relatively nascent, is rapidly becoming pivotal in the modern corporate world. As AI continues to permeate every business facet, the CAIO emerges as the torchbearer, ensuring that AI's potential is harnessed, its challenges navigated, and its benefits realized to the fullest. To excel in this role, a unique blend of technical knowledge, strategic vision, leadership, and a continuous thirst for learning is essential. As businesses increasingly recognize AI's transformative power, the CAIO's skills set becomes the linchpin for future success.
